Track Guide

This weekend 3 Fox Superflow tracks are operating both days with the added PRO track on Sunday only.

  • Fox – Starting at the far end of “Baileys” not dropping onto “Elevator but continuing on “Baileys” to drop into “BnB’s. Track is 1.6km long and descends 100m of vertical.
  • Stan – Starting from the near end of “Baileys” and traversing parallel to the road before crossing the road to drop into the end of “Explosions”. Track in 1.3km and descends approx. 70m of vertical.
  • Lazer – Starting at the same place as STANS, LAZER will descend Three Hills then descend Comms Games 1 fun stuff to the event hub. Track is 2.2 km long with over 130m of vertical drop
  • MTB Direct PRO Stage (Sunday only) – Inspired by the Gold Coast MTB Club and their track at the 2022 GE state champs the Pro track will start next to the FOX track but drop down the “Yarranye” fire road using water bars and benches to add technicality. It will finish on the link through to “Happy Valley” for an easy lap back to the starts. Remember full face helmets are compulsory. MTB Direct track is 1km long and drops 110m of vertical.

Race Format

Superflow® Race Format, full weekend of racing available . This event offers the PRO Stage on the Sunday in addition.

Fox Superflow® Classic Format: 3 TIMED TRACKS, 5 RUNS, FASTEST ON EACH COUNTS!

Superflow® PRO Stage Format: 4 TIMED Tracks (ie, one additional one to the 3 stages), 5 runs, Fastest on each counts. You get the Pro Result in addition to the 3-stage classic format. More info & Pro Format FAQ’s here…

REMEMBER NO VEHICLE OR TOW SHUTTLES ALLOWED.

  • At EVERY RACE we are offer 3 epic, gravity enduro stages called Fox, Stans & Lazer, plus an additional 4th Pro Track for this event.
  • Racing is all weekend .
  • Racing starts at 9:00 am and you have till 3:30 pm to complete a minimum of 1 run per track to get a placing.
  • You choose what order you ride the stages in.
  • Ride each stage up to 5 times each, thats up to 15 race runs in total plus PRO (if you have the legs!)
  • Stages are an average of 2-3 minutes long, with untimed liaisons so take your time and chat with your mates.
  • Return to the race village at any time for food, support or to rest!
  • Technical assistance is permitted anywhere outside of your race runs.
  • The fastest time on each race track gets added up to the final result across skill and age group classifications.
